The shape of the IUD

The IUD is a relatively common contraceptive method, especially among some women of childbearing age in my country, who often use this method for contraception. It is simple and effective, lasts for a relatively long time, and avoids some external contraceptive methods. There are many types of IUDs, and they come in various shapes. For example, there are many shapes of IUDs, such as bow-shaped, T-shaped, or V-shaped. Among them, the T-shaped ring is the most commonly used one. Let us briefly learn about this aspect.

When is the right time to remove the IUD?

The IUD is a commonly used method of contraception for women. It is safe, effective and has few side effects. However, the use of the IUD has a time limit. When the IUD reaches a certain age, it needs to be removed and replaced. So when is the right time to remove the IUD?

If the inserted ring has reached the prescribed period, you should go to the hospital to remove the ring in time to prevent the ring from deforming or becoming ineffective in the uterus. Generally, metal rings can be stored for 20 years, silicone rubber V-rings can be stored for 7 to 10 years, and copper sleeve T-rings can be stored for 10 to 15 years. A new ring can be put in while removing the ring.

The best time to remove the IUD should be chosen according to different women. If a general woman of childbearing age needs to get pregnant, the best time to remove the IUD is 3-5 days after the menstruation ends, and it is best to do it half a year or one year in advance. If a menopausal woman needs to remove the IUD, it is generally most appropriate to remove the IUD within 6 months to one year after menopause. Removing the IUD too early or too late will have an impact on the body. If the contraceptive ring inserted into a woman's body has reached its expiration date or if there is obvious discomfort after the ring is inserted, the ring should be removed as soon as possible.
